Title :
A study of EDM machine waveform monitoring and nano silver manufacturing process optimization

Abstract :
The advantage of applying the EDM (electric discharge machine) in the preparation of nano-fluids is that it does not require chemicals, unlike other nano-manufacturing methods that use chemicals to increase particle stability. Moreover, the operation of EDM is simple and without complex processes. This study proposes a discharge success rate measurement system to determine discharge effectiveness and seek the optimal discharge control parameter settings. Its advantage is the ability to observe the success rate curve every 0.1 seconds to learn the discharge quality. Studies of nano silver have suggested that the same duty cycle, shorter discharge, and repose can result in a higher success rate. When Ton uses 10μs as the fixed value, and only the ratio of Toff increases, the success rate of 10-100μs is the highest. Without the pursuit of processing speed, the setting of 10-100μs of a high discharge success rate is the optimal parameter setting.
